Output ceb7706c9513d4e8d6609f90fbd576885cf402e8e7f66d66bec9f7b20c4e9589:0

value
21348302
script pubkey
OP_0 OP_PUSHBYTES_20 a8aa3853547c9fce45ba6dc5842c1fdd25e5d632
address
bc1q4z4rs5650j0uu3d6dhzcgtqlm5j7t43j0uh643
transaction
ceb7706c9513d4e8d6609f90fbd576885cf402e8e7f66d66bec9f7b20c4e9589
confirmations
330890
spent
true